3 stars This record sounds a lot like PINK FLOYD during their "The Wall" and "The Final Cut" albums.The singer here really reminds me of Roger Waters, and the guitarist has his Gilmour impressions down pat. This record is very well wriiten, and performed at a high level. There is some variety as well, including some Blues and straight up Rock numbers, and several instrumentals.

This is a concept album that would be better explained by going on their website. Highlights for me are "Mainstream" a very PINK FLOYD sounding mellow tune, featuring acoustic guitar and softer vocals, though the song does grow to be more intense. And "Blood From A Stone" is very proggy, and the previous song an instrumental "High In The Himalayas" is a beautiful but short tune with keyboards and acoustic guitar.

This is a good release that PINK FLOYD fans may be interested in, as well as those who like concept albums.
